Elżbieta Kaczmarzyk – Janczak is a graduate of the Wrocław Music Academy, vocal acting department

Still as a V-th year student she won the first prize on the V Ada Sari Contest held in Nowy Sącz in 1993. In 1994 she found herself amongst the finalists in the International Vocal Contest in Bilbao (Spain), and in 1999 she won the III Prize on the International V. Bellini Vocal Contest in Italy.

She is repeatedly invited to local and international Festivals like.Wratislavia Cantans (since 1991 till 1997, 2000, 2001), The International Opera Festival in Xanten, Holland (1997, 1998, 2000, 2001), The Polish Music Days In Amsterdam (1993), The Polish Music festival in Hamburg (1991, 1992) The Europa Cantans Festival – Strassburg (1989, 1992),The Moniuszko Festival in Kudowa (1997, 1999), and many other.

She had concerts in USA (1991) and in Europe, amongst others in Germany, Holland, France, Spain, Switzerland, Sweden, Norway, Italy, Russia, Belgium.

In Poland she sang a mezzo-soprano part, composed by W. Sutryk especially for her, in the world premiere of Space Requiem oratorio, in memory of Challenger space shuttle catastrophe Challenger.

Since 1993 she has been a soloist with the Wrocław Opera Theatre (Opera Dolnośląska) where she made her debut singing the Fenen’s part in Nabucco by G.Verdi. In her artistic career she sang numerous significant parts highly appreciated by both critics and the audience including: the title parts in Carmen by G.Bizet and L`Italiana in Algieri by G.Rossiniego, also in Nabucco, Rigoletto, Falstaff, La Traviata, Il Trovatore by G.Verdi.

Her repertoire includes over 25 opera and ca 20 oratorio parts in total.

She has had numerous overseas tours in her professional career, with the Wrocław Opera Theatre or on her own, including: Holland (Carmen, Faust 1997, 1998, 1999), Germany (Nabucco 1997, Carmen 1998), England (Nabucco, La Traviata 1998), Taiwan (Nabucco, Il Trovatore 2001).

She records radio broadcasts and TV programmes, also she has recorded a few CD discs. 

In 2000, as the first Polish mezzo-soprano, she recorded the first Polish CD with G. Verdi opera Il Trovatore singing Azucena’s part. The record was nominated to a prestigious Fryderyk prize.

In the same year she was decorated by President of the Republic of Poland with a Bronze Cross for Merits.

She co-operates on continuous basis with other Opera Theatres in Poland including: The Opera Theatre in Bydgoszcz, Gdańsk, Lublin, The Grand Theatre in Łódź, Opera Theatre in Solingen (Germany) and Concert Halls in: Płock, Szczecin, Opole, Wrocław.

Elżbieta Kaczmarzyk made her début in Germany in Deutsche Opern am Rhein (Dusseldorf) during the spring of 2005 as Amneris in G. Verdi Aida.

In september she was decorated by President of the Republic of Poland with a Silver Cross for Merits.
